Polyurethane foam is a type of synthetic material that is known for its ability to absorb sound waves. It is made up of tiny cells that trap sound waves as they travel through the material, preventing them from passing through and causing noise pollution. This makes polyurethane foam an ideal material for soundproofing applications in homes, offices, and commercial spaces.
One of the key properties of polyurethane foam that makes it effective for noise reduction is its density. The density of the foam determines how effectively it can absorb sound waves. Higher density foam is more effective at absorbing sound waves than lower density foam. This is why it is important to choose the right density of polyurethane foam for your soundproofing needs.
In addition to density, the thickness of the foam also plays a role in its noise reduction capabilities. Thicker foam can absorb more sound waves and provide better soundproofing. However, it is important to strike a balance between thickness and cost, as thicker foam is often more expensive.
Another important property of polyurethane foam for noise reduction is its flexibility. Foam that is too rigid may not conform to the shape of the space where it is installed, leaving gaps where sound can still travel through. Flexible foam can be easily cut and shaped to fit snugly into any space, ensuring maximum soundproofing effectiveness.

When it comes to reducing noise levels, polyurethane foam has several key advantages. One of the primary benefits of polyurethane foam is its ability to absorb sound waves. Sound waves are essentially vibrations that travel through the air and can be absorbed or reflected by different materials. Polyurethane foam is particularly effective at absorbing sound waves, thanks to its open-cell structure. This structure allows the foam to trap and dissipate sound energy, preventing it from bouncing around the room and creating echoes.

Polyurethane foam is a type of foam that is created by reacting polyol and diisocyanate, resulting in a material that is known for its durability and flexibility. It is commonly used in a variety of applications, including insulation, cushioning, and soundproofing. When it comes to noise reduction, polyurethane foam is an ideal choice due to its ability to absorb sound waves and minimize their impact on the surrounding environment.
When selecting polyurethane foam for noise reduction purposes, there are a few key factors to consider. One important consideration is the density of the foam. Higher density foams are more effective at absorbing sound waves and reducing noise levels. Additionally, the thickness of the foam is also important, as thicker foam will provide better soundproofing capabilities.
Another important factor to consider when choosing polyurethane foam for noise reduction is the type of foam. There are several types of polyurethane foam available, including open-cell foam, closed-cell foam, and acoustic foam. Open-cell foam is soft and porous, making it ideal for absorbing sound waves. Closed-cell foam, on the other hand, is denser and more rigid, providing better insulation and soundproofing capabilities. Acoustic foam is specifically designed for soundproofing applications and is often used in recording studios and home theaters.
